Anyone had issues with Slicer not opening .sla files?
I'm opening the right file, I did it earlier today. But it suddenly stopped opening files.
It doesn't open any other .sla file either.
I tried restarting my computer, redownloading everything and reinstalling the slicer again and it didn't help.
EDIT:
I solved this issue pretty quickly myself. I turned off HDR in Windows. WTF

I'm hearing some grinding sound for about half a second, like the plate is getting stuck on something. It does this only when it's going up, not down (so it's most likely not damaging the screen). This also only happens when it's printing to around 30-50%, after that the sound disappears.
Might need some oiling? Anyone else had a similar issue?

Uneven bottom as well as beginning of the tail being a bit thinner most likely caused by uneven bottom.
When I removed the model, the platform support wasn't completely stuck to the plate, instead part of it was hanging (the sides that are a bit raised in the picture)
Would increasing bottom exposure time fix this?
The alien was printed at 120s bottom exposure time. I have since then changed to 180s and some newer prints still have edges of the platform hanging, which basically ruins many prints.
So I guess I should go higher? 300s for "heavier" models?
Or do I need to do something else?

My most successful print (primed in white).
However the orc warrior is very brittle. I dropped her on the ground from about 1m height and one of the arms fell off. Had to glue it back.
2 questions:
1) why brittle? Too much UV exposure? I exposed her about 40 minutes on 360nm uv (anycubic resin, rated for 405nm)
2) what glue to use? I used superglue but had to spend a lot of time waiting for it to actually stick.
